:root{--bg:#0b0c10;--fg:#eaeef2;--muted:#9aa3af;--card:#111218;--ring:#2b2f36;--header:#0f1117;--link:#c7d2fe}#loading{position:fixed;inset:0;background:#000;color:#fff;display:flex;align-items:center;justify-content:center;font-size:1.5rem;z-index:1000}*{box-sizing:border-box}html,body{height:100%}body{margin:0;font-family:Inter,system-ui,-apple-system,Segoe\ UI,Roboto,"Helvetica Neue",Arial,"Noto Sans","Apple Color Emoji","Segoe UI Emoji";background:radial-gradient(1200px 800px at 50% -20%,#141622 0%,#0b0c10 60%,#0b0c10 100%);color:var(--fg)}.skip-link{position:absolute;left:-999px;top:-999px}.skip-link:focus{left:12px;top:12px;background:var(--card);color:var(--fg);padding:8px 12px;border-radius:8px}.site-header{position:sticky;top:0;background:linear-gradient(180deg,rgba(17,18,24,.9),rgba(11,12,16,.85));backdrop-filter:saturate(140%) blur(10px);border-bottom:1px solid var(--ring);z-index:0;height:100px}.header-inner{display:flex;align-items:center;justify-content:space-between;height:56px}.brand-link{color:#fff;font-weight:800;text-decoration:none}.primary-nav{display:flex;gap:12px}.primary-nav a{color:var(--muted);text-decoration:none;padding:8px 10px;border-radius:8px}.primary-nav a[aria-current="page"],.primary-nav a:hover{color:#fff;background:#151725}.container{max-width:680px;margin:0 auto;padding:48px 20px 64px}.profile{display:flex;flex-direction:column;align-items:center;gap:12px;text-align:center}.avatar{width:104px;height:104px;border-radius:50%;border:2px solid var(--ring);box-shadow:0 8px 24px rgba(0,0,0,.35)}.name{font-size:28px;line-height:1.2;margin:8px 0 0}.bio{color:var(--muted);margin:0 0 8px}.links{display:grid;grid-template-columns:1fr;gap:14px;margin:28px 0 10px}.link-button{appearance:none;display:inline-flex;align-items:center;justify-content:center;border-radius:12px;color:#fff;text-decoration:none;font-weight:800;letter-spacing:.2px;background:rgba(255,174,82,.849);border:1px solid #1f2230;position:relative;overflow:hidden;transition:transform .06s ease , box-shadow .2s ease , filter .2s ease}.link-button span{position:relative;z-index:1}.link-button:hover{filter:brightness(1.05);box-shadow:0 4px 16px rgba(255,174,82,.4)}.link-button:active{transform:translateY(1px)}.social{display:flex;align-items:center;justify-content:center;gap:14px;margin-top:10px}.social-icon{color:var(--muted);width:40px;height:40px;display:inline-flex;align-items:center;justify-content:center;border-radius:10px;background:var(--card);border:1px solid var(--ring);text-decoration:none;transition:background .2s ease , color .2s ease}.social-icon:hover{color:var(--fg);background:#151725}.footer{margin-top:28px;text-align:center;color:var(--muted)}.footer .powered{margin-top:6px}.footer a{color:var(--link);text-decoration:none}.footer a:hover{text-decoration:underline}@media (min-width:640px){.links{gap:16px}.link-button{padding:16px 20px}}body::after{content:"";position:fixed;inset:0;background-image:var(--dynamic-bg,none);background-size:cover;background-position:center;opacity:0;transition:opacity .6s ease-in-out;z-index:-1;pointer-events:none}body.bg-active::after{opacity:1}